Introduction

In a significant ruling in Missouri, a registered sex offender has been sentenced to 20 years in prison for committing a new child pornography crime. This case highlights ongoing issues related to child exploitation and the legal mechanisms aimed at protecting vulnerable populations. In this article, we explore the details of the case, its ramifications, and the broader implications for society.

Background on the Defendant

The defendant, whose identity has not been publicly disclosed due to legal regulations, had a prior conviction relating to sexual offenses against minors. Despite being a registered sex offender, he engaged in activities that directly undermined the safety of children in his community. This case underlines the challenges law enforcement faces in monitoring repeat offenders.

Details of the Crime

In this particular case, investigators found substantial evidence against the defendant, including disturbing material that depicted the sexual exploitation of minors. The investigation was initiated based on tips received by law enforcement, which led to an in-depth examination of the defendant’s background and digital activities.

Evidence Presentation

During the trial, prosecutors presented compelling evidence that highlighted the defendant’s repeated offenses, emphasizing the need for a strong punitive response. The evidence included recovered files and testimony from expert witnesses who elucidated the trauma inflicted upon victims of child exploitation.

Sentencing Outcomes

The court ultimately decided on a 20-year sentence, a decision applauded by child advocacy groups and law enforcement agencies. The severity of the punishment reflects the growing concern over child pornography and its implications for society.
